Action for Children~Zambia (AFCZ) has leadership and volunteers in several countries and a dedicated staff in Zambia.

In Zambia, the program is run by founder and director Carol McBrady, who coordinates not only the activities within Zambia but the operations of the supporting organizations in other countries. All other staff involved with AFCZ in Zambia are native Zambians, most with extensive past experience working with at-risk, vulnerable and displaced children and young adults. In addition, several local Zambian colleges partnered with AFCZ, and we regularly welcome student interns practicing their social work skills. This community-based staff helps the children keep their connection with Zambian culture and society while providing western social work practices that are particularly helpful to street children, such as counselling, foster care and behavior modification. 

In the U.S.A., AFCZ is run by a network of volunteers including a board of directors that works with Carol to coordinate fundraising, public awareness, compliance with charitable giving regulations and support for the organization. Throughout the other countries providing support for AFCZ, a team of volunteers manages fundraisers and public awareness events.

Staff Training and Team Building

We are truly grateful for the wonderful team we have in Zambia. During a 4-day training session, Mama Carol McBrady facilitated discussions and teaching around the topic of child protection. We brought in our counselors from the Abundance of Hope clinic and they taught us about childhood trauma and the effects that has on our children. We spent a full day on behavior management and also discussed personnel and human resource issues. We learned many great things!
